在数字钱包生态中,验证tpwallet真伪需要从密码学、系统工程与经济模型三维度开展全方位测试。首先进行源代码与二进制一致性比对(reproducible builds)、签名校验与供应链审计,参照NIST密钥管理指南(NIST SP 800‑57)与比特币白皮书(Satoshi, 2008)。
防重放攻击方面,应验证交易是否采用链ID/域分隔(如EIP‑155)、递增nonce/序列号、时间窗与一次性签名机制;测试流程需构造跨链与离线重放场景,确认节点或合约能拒绝旧交易。余额查询要保证可信性,建议采用多源校验、Merkle包含证明(SPV)与完整节点比对,结合链上索引器与JSON‑RPC响应,避免中间人或API层篡改结果。
轻节点测试关注SPV头同步、Merkle树校验、断点重连与在带宽/延迟恶劣环境下的数据完整性;应模拟断网重连与分叉恢复场景,验证轻节点不会接受伪造证明。多功能数字钱包的发展方向包括多链资产管理、硬件隔离、多重签名、社恢复、DeFi合约交互与NFT管理;测试需覆盖权限边界、合约调用序列与滑点/重入等经济攻击面。

智能化技术趋势正在推动钱包安全从被动防御向主动检测转型:在设备端部署模型进行异常行为识别、结合联邦学习保护数据隐私、利用TEE/SE强化密钥隔离,并用自动化静态/动态审计工具提升审计覆盖率。测试tpwallet真伪的详细流程建议如下:1)信息收集(版本、签名、依赖);2)静态审计(代码与协议);3)编译与二进制一致性校验;4)动态测试(单元、模糊、渗透);5)网络与API抓包验证;6)链上交互与重放攻击模拟;7)轻节点与Merkle证明验证;8)风险评估与合规对照(ISO/IEC、NIST)。

结论:结合权威标准、可复现的测试用例与多层防护(密码、协议、实现、经济激励),可显著提升对tpwallet真实性的判定能力与防护效果。参考文献:Satoshi Nakamoto, Bitcoin (2008);Ethereum EIP‑155;NIST SP 800‑57。
评论
Alex_Wang
很实用的测试流程,尤其是重放攻击模拟部分,能否提供具体测试用例?
小雨
引用了NIST和EIP,提升了权威性,文章条理清晰,受益匪浅。
TechGuru
建议补充对硬件安全模块(HSM/TEE)与社恢复机制的实操测试细节。
王思远
关于轻节点的Merkle证明验证,能否举例说明如何在低带宽场景做完整性校验?